The question of life on Venus, of all places, is intriguing enough that a team of U.S. and Russian scientists working on a proposal for a new mission to the second planet — named Venera-D — are considering including the search for life in its mission goals. If all goes as planned, an unmanned aerial vehicle (UAV) could one day be cruising the thick, sulfuric-acid clouds of Venus to help determine whether dark streaks that appear to absorb ultraviolet radiation could be evidence of microbial life.

Comparing Venus’ Atmosphere to Earth

In light of this, an important test will be to investigate and identify whether or not any other bodies in the solar system contain life. Mars has always been a good potential candidate, as well as some of the satellites of Jupiter and Saturn, such as Europa and Enceladus, which may contain vast subterranean liquid oceans. Another candidate, which may be surprising to some, is the planet Venus. Although the surface of Venus is an extremely inhospitable place, the upper atmosphere of Venus is actually one of the most similar environments of another body to those found on Earth.
